Igniz
AI-native DEX for autonomous, non-custodial trading
Igniz is an AI-native perpetual and spot DEX built for high-performance futures and spot trading. It combines institutional-grade infrastructure with autonomous AI-powered execution, featuring low-latency order matching, advanced liquidity management, and a professional trading interface for retail and institutional users. With Agentic AI Trading, intelligent autonomous agents analyze markets, execute strategies, and optimize performance with minimal human intervention.
We built Igniz because truly autonomous decentralized trading remained an unsolved problem. Most DEXs force you to choose between speed, autonomy, and trust. Igniz solves that by combining institutional-grade DEX infrastructure with AI agents that analyze markets and execute strategies with minimal human intervention so you can trade faster and smarter without ever giving up control of your funds.

Igniz was hunted by Mubasser Iqbal. A “hunter” on Product Hunt is the community member who submits a product to the platform — uploading the images, the link, and tagging the makers behind it. Hunters typically write the first comment explaining why a product is worth attention, and their followers are notified the moment they post. Around 79% of featured launches on Product Hunt are self-hunted by their makers, but a well-known hunter still acts as a signal of quality to the rest of the community.
